IRONMAN Lake Placid Pro Start List

Friday 19 July 2024

A robust field featuring many of the world’s best professional triathletes will toe the start line at the Athletic Brewing IRONMAN® Lake Placid triathlon, part of the VinFast IRONMAN North America Series, when the IRONMAN Pro Series™ returns to the U.S. on Sunday, July 21. The 2024 Athletic Brewing IRONMAN Lake Placid triathlon will offer professionals a maximum of 5,000 points towards IRONMAN Pro Series standings, a $125,000 event total pro prize purse, and four qualifying slots for each gender to the 2024 VinFast IRONMAN World Championship triathlons in Nice, France (women), or Kona, Hawai`i (men).
 
With a field that includes five of the top 10 professional women and six of the Top 10 professional men in the current IRONMAN Pro Series standings set to compete, the event can be seen live in person and will be broadcast for free across multiple platforms for global viewers including proseries.ironman.com, Outside TV, DAZN and L'Equipe in France, and YouTube among others.
 
Returning to defend her title will be Alice Alberts (USA) who currently sits in 8th place in the standings after three IRONMAN Pro Series race appearances. Australian Kylie Simpson, who currently sits 2nd in the standings, enters her third full-distance IRONMAN of the year and fifth IRONMAN Pro Series race just over a month after a podium finish at the Cairns Airport IRONMAN Asia-Pacific Championship Cairns. Jackie Hering (USA), who sits 4th in the standings comes in fresh off an inspiring victory at the IRONMAN European Championship Hamburg and will make her first appearance in Lake Placid in over ten years. Dutch professional, Lotte Wilms, currently sitting in 5th place in the standings, will look to add to her podium finishes this year following a 2nd place finish in Cairns and a 3rd place finish in Texas. Danielle Lewis (USA), who currently sits 7th in the standings, is primed for another good result following four top ten finishes in four IRONMAN Pro Series races.
 
Other challengers include Penny Slater (AUS) (22nd in the standings); Erin Schenkels (CAN) (14th in the standings); Lesley Smith (USA) (15th in the standings); and 2022 IRONMAN Lake Placid Champion Sarah True (USA) who will return to the Adirondacks looking for her first victory of the year and to improve on her 33rd place standing in the IRONMAN Pro Series.
 
Scheduled to make their IRONMAN Pro Series debut will be Ruth Astle (GBR); Jodie Robertson (USA) and Regan Hollioake (AUS) who is one to watch after winning the IRONMAN Australia race in May in her rookie year as a professional triathlete.
 
In the highly competitive men’s professional fields, Joe Skipper (GBR) will return to defend his 2023 title while also looking to improve on his 16th place standing following four appearances in the IRONMAN Pro Series this year. Among others to watch will be Matt Hanson (USA) who currently sits atop the IRONMAN Pro Series standings and whose best result in Lake Placid came as a third-place finish in 2023; Jackson Laundry (CAN) will be stepping up to undertake only his 2nd full-distance IRONMAN race across his 8 years and currently sits 2nd in standings, while Lionel Sanders (CAN) will be making the Athletic Brewing IRONMAN Lake Placid race his first full-distance IRONMAN race of the year, currently sitting 21st in the standings.
 
Other top contenders include Chris Leiferman (USA) (6th in the standings); Justin Riele (USA) (7th in the standings); Matthew Marquardt (USA) (10th in the standings); Braden Currie (NZL) (13th in the standings); Colin Szuch (USA) (3rd in the standings); and Arnaud Guilloux (FRA) (12th in the standings). Scheduled to make their IRONMAN Pro Series debut will be Bart Aernouts (BEL), and Ben Stern (USA)
 
Celebrating 25 years, the 2024 Athletic Brewing IRONMAN Lake Placid triathlon, part of the VinFast IRONMAN North America Series, will see athletes kick off their 140.6-mile journey with a 2.4-mile swim in the Mirror Lake before athletes embark on the 112-mile bike course with great views of the Adirondacks passing through the towns of Keene, Jay, Wilmington and Lake Placid. The 26.2-mile run course takes athletes through the city center to picturesque Mirror Lake before the culmination of their day at the historic Lake Placid Olympic Oval.
 
Marking a quarter-century of unforgettable moments and incredible achievements at the iconic North American event, the Athletic Brewing IRONMAN Lake Placid triathlon will celebrate its 25th anniversary this July. In addition, approximately 2,600 registered athletes are expected to toe the start line at Mirror Lake and are in for a special treat as the “Voice of IRONMAN,” Mike Reilly, who retired at the end of the 2022 season, will return for a special occasion to call the 25th anniversary of the event bringing yet another exciting element to this year’s celebration.
